Chemin de la Vy Marchand
Chemin de la Vy Marchand is a power-hike climb above Savagnier in Neuchâtel. At 4.2 TEP it sits around the middle of the catalogue. Expect 21 to 35 minutes. Its steepest 500 metres run at 19.8% and start 1.4 km in, so the worst of it lands when you are already committed. Mostly on gravel and farm tracks. Southwest-facing: it takes the full afternoon heat.
